After a rigorous analysis of performance, innovations, and impacts within the energy sector, four African energy ministers have been recognized as the top leaders by Le Brief. These ministers have demonstrated outstanding contributions to shaping the energy future of their respective countries and the continent.
Mamadou SANGAFOWA-COULIBALY from Côte d'Ivoire 🇨🇮
As a pioneer of energy reforms, Mamadou SANGAFOWA-COULIBALY has strengthened energy independence and promoted sustainable investments. His leadership has been crucial in modernizing Côte d'Ivoire’s energy infrastructure, focusing on renewable energy integration, and ensuring reliable energy access across the country. His efforts have placed Côte d'Ivoire at the forefront of West Africa’s energy transformation.
Birame Souleye DIOP from Senegal 🇸🇳
Recognized as a visionary and the master of change, Birame Souleye DIOP has been instrumental in negotiating bold energy contracts and implementing groundbreaking reforms in Senegal’s energy sector. His innovative approach has helped transform Senegal into a leader in energy, especially in renewable energy development, and has drawn international attention to the country’s growing energy potential.
Karim Badawi from Egypt 🇪🇬
Known as the architect of ambitious solar and nuclear energy projects, Karim Badawi has played a pivotal role in transforming Egypt into a regional energy hub. His work on expanding solar power and launching nuclear energy initiatives has set Egypt on a path toward energy diversification and sustainability, making the country a key player in the region’s energy landscape.
Tom Alweendo from Namibia 🇳🇦
A strategic leader, Tom Alweendo has successfully leveraged emerging energy resources to support Namibia's economic growth. His forward-thinking approach to energy policy has enabled Namibia to harness its renewable energy potential, including solar and wind power, to fuel its development and strengthen its energy security.
These ministers symbolize the dynamism and determination of Africa in the global energy transition. Their visionary leadership and commitment to sustainable energy are helping to drive the continent's progress toward a cleaner, more resilient energy future
